HireQuest (HQI) Investor presentation summary
Event summary combining transcript, slides, and related documents.
Investor presentation summary
11 May, 2026Financial performance and growth
Maintained net income positivity every year since 2002, excluding one-time transaction fees and expenses.
System-wide sales grew 1.8x, adjusted EBITDA 1.5x, and adjusted EPS 2.6x from 2019 to 2025.
Total market share increased 85% between 2019 and 2025, with total sales up 56.9%.
Demonstrated resilience, with staffing sales declining only 6.1% from industry peak in 2022 to 2025, compared to a 27.4% industry decline.
Pro forma adjusted EBITDA reached $14.7m in 2025, up from $10.0m in 2019.
Strategic initiatives and capital allocation
Completed over 15 M&A transactions since 2019, spending $77m in cash and generating $29m from resale of acquired locations.
Paid $18m in dividends and executed $9m in share buybacks since 2019.
Maintained low leverage, with $0 debt at the end of 2025 and maximum leverage of 0.9x since 2019.
Fully diluted shares increased only 2.4% from 2019 to 2025, minimizing shareholder dilution.
Franchise model and operational advantages
Franchise model delivers high-margin, less volatile royalty revenue compared to traditional staffing.
Streamlined cost structure as franchisees manage branch operations, reducing corporate overhead.
Franchisees drive local strategy, supported by centralized tools and resources.
Enables rapid integration of acquisitions and generates incremental cash flow through resale to franchisees.
Provides consistent profitability and downside protection across economic cycles.
